Probabilistic Assignment of NMR Spectra of Organic Crystals

Solid-state nuclear magnetic resonance (NMR) spectroscopy a method that calculates the frequencies produced by the nuclei of certain atoms exposed to radio waves in a powerful magnetic field can be used to establish chemical and 3D structures as well as the dynamics of materials and molecules. ....

The behavior of the solvated electron e-aq has fundamental implications for electrochemistry, photochemistry, high-energy chemistry, as well as for biology its nonequilibrium precursor is responsible for radiation damage to DNA and it has understandably been the topic of experimental and theoretical investigation for more than 50 years.
Though the hydrated electron appears to be simple it is the smallest possible anion as well as the simplest reducing agent in chemistry capturing its physics is.hard. They are short lived and generated in small quantities and so impossible to concentrate and isolate.
